Myth 1: Cash Offers Are Always Low

Many believe that cash offers are inherently lower than traditional offers. While it's true that some investors might offer less, this isn't always the case. Cash buyers often provide competitive offers, especially when they value the unique aspects of your property. Additionally, avoiding the lengthy mortgage approval process can be worth the slight difference in price.

Myth 2: Cash Sales Are Only for Distressed Properties

Another common myth is that only distressed or "ugly" houses are sold for cash. In reality, homeowners choose cash sales for various reasons. Whether you're relocating, settling an estate, or simply want a quick transaction, cash sales can be ideal for well-maintained homes too.

The Speed and Simplicity of Cash Transactions

One of the primary benefits of a cash sale is speed. Without the need for bank approvals and lengthy inspections, the process can be completed in just days. This quick turnaround is appealing for those who need to move fast or avoid prolonged uncertainty.

Myth 3: Cash Buyers Are Untrustworthy

Some sellers worry about the trustworthiness of cash buyers. While it's important to do your due diligence, most cash buyers are reputable investors or companies with a track record in real estate. Research and ask for references to ensure you're dealing with a legitimate buyer.

Assessing the True Value of Cash Offers

Understanding the true value of a cash offer goes beyond the dollar amount. Consider the savings on repairs, commissions, and closing costs. These factors often make a cash offer more appealing when you look at the net gain.

Myth 4: You Have to Accept the First Cash Offer

Some sellers feel pressured to accept the first cash offer they receive. Remember, as a seller, you have the right to negotiate. Evaluating multiple offers and consulting with a real estate professional can help you make the best decision.
